Understanding the Basics of Emergency Treatment Courses
Before joining in any first aid training course, it's critical to familiarize yourself with the various programs offered. Each training course has unique focuses and results:

- HLTAID011 Give Initial Aid: This course covers basic first aid abilities appropriate in different settings. HLTAID009 Give CPR Focus: Aimed at teaching life-saving mouth-to-mouth resuscitation techniques. HLTAID012 Give Emergency treatment in Education: Tailored for educators that need certain skills for college environments. HLTAID014 Offer Advanced First Aid: For those wanting to obtain sophisticated skills that exceed fundamental first aid.
Understanding these distinctions will certainly help you select the best course straightened with your goals.

ID Checks: Why They Matter
When register in a first aid training course, suppliers typically carry out ID look for numerous factors:
Verification of Identity: Makes certain that the private signing up is without a doubt that they claim to be. Compliance with Regulations: Helps training organizations fulfill legal obligations. Record Keeping: Helps maintain accurate documents for future audits.Most frequently approved types of ID include driver's licenses, tickets, or various other government-issued identification.

Exploring RPL (Recognition of Prior Learning)
RPL enables people who currently possess appropriate knowledge or experience (such as previous training) to get credit scores toward a new certification without repeating previously covered web content. This is specifically beneficial if you've undergone prior training but wish to get official accreditation under Australian guidelines.

Frequently Asked Concerns (FAQs)
1. What is the period of the majority of first aid courses?
Most standard programs run between 1-- 2 days depending upon the degree of qualification being pursued.
2. Is there an age restriction for joining these courses?
Generally speaking, participants need to go to least 14 years old; nonetheless, some companies might provide certain youth-targeted programs.
3. Can I take these courses online?
Yes! Many providers use online versions together with in person choices; however practical components are usually needed under supervision.
4. For how long is my first-aid certification valid?
Typically, qualifications last in between three years before requiring revival through refresher course training or re-assessment processes like HLTAID009 Provide mouth-to-mouth resuscitation focus every year.
